POLICE have released an image of a man they wish to speak to about a sexual assault in Bury.

A 14-year-old girl was assaulted in Croft Street on Saturday June 22, 2019.

The girl was walking along the street between 12.30pm and 12.45pm, when a man approached her and sexually assaulted her.

The man then ran off in the direction of the Iceland Food store in Rochdale Road.

The girl was uninjured during the attack.

Police Constable Luke Gregory of GMP’s Bury district said: “We are asking the public to take a good look at the photo we are releasing and would appeal directly to anybody that recognises the man pictured to please get in touch.

“Since the incident occurred we have followed numerous lines of enquiries to trace the offender. We now turn to the general public to assist our investigation.

“We appreciate that this incident may cause concern among residents in the local community but I want to make it very clear that we are doing all that we can to trace the person responsible.”
